UCL: Why I started Chukwueze against Newcastle United – Pioli

AC Milan manager, Stefano Pioli has provided an insight on why he started Samuel Chukwueze in his side’s UEFA Champions League clash against Newcastle United on Tuesday night.

The encounter at the San Siro ended in a barren draw with the hosts wasting a couple of clear cut chances.

Chukwueze was named in the starting line-up for the first time since linking up with the Rooseneri from LaLiga club, Villarreal in the summer.

The 24-year-old was in action for 61 minutes before he was replaced by Christian Pulisic.

Pioli explained his decision to start the Nigeria international.

“Chukwueze is rapid, good at one-on-one situations, taking on a tall and physical full-back, but one with a very different pace to him. Pobega is very good at running into the box and entering those spaces,” he was quoted by Football Italia.
